Based on size alone, up to 95% of intermodal containers comply with ISO standards, [2] and can officially be called ISO containers. These containers are known by many names: freight container, sea container , ocean container , container van or sea van , sea can or C can , or MILVAN , [ 3 ] [ 4 ] or SEAVAN .
Intermediate bulk containers are standardized shipping containers often UN/DOT certified for the transport handling of hazardous and non-hazardous, packing group II and packing group III commodities. Many IBC totes are manufactured according to federal and NSF / ANSI regulations and mandates and are often IMDG approved as well for domestic and ...

Gastronorm originated in Switzerland during the 1960s when various associations gathered and agreed on standard dimensions for movable kitchen inserts and containers such as pans, trays, wire racks as well as other kitchen utensils and equipment.
